Mise en page de la base de données MSSQL pour les SMS

Cette page vous donne la mise en page de la base de données à utiliser lorsque vous souhaitez configurer une solution SQL vers SMS. Vous verrez que deux tables de base de données doivent être créées. L'une sera utilisée pour envoyer des messages SMS et l'autre pour les recevoir. Ce guide vous montre comment vous connecter à votre serveur MS SQL et comment créer ces deux tables de base de données.

Contenu
1. Se connecter à MSSQL Express
2. Copier l'instruction CREATE TABLE
3. Exécuter l'instruction CREATE TABLE

Vidéo 1 - Comment configurer une solution SQL vers SMS (Tutoriel vidéo)

Veuillez faire défiler vers le bas pour copier les instructions CREATE TABLE utilisées dans la vidéo. Si vous avez créé la base de données dans MSSQL Express, vous pouvez passer à la vidéo suivante.

Tout d'abord, vous devez être capable de créer des bases de données SQL avec une invite de commandes. Pour ce faire, veuillez exécuter "cmd" sur votre ordinateur et tapez "sqlcmd". Après avoir appuyé sur Entrée, vous pourrez exécuter des instructions SQL directement depuis cmd. Ces instructions créent la base de données pour les messages entrants et sortants, les identifiants de connexion et définissent les droits nécessaires pour les utilisateurs. Vous pouvez voir le résultat sur la Figure 1.

se connecter à la base de données microsoft sql express
Figure 1 - Se connecter à la base de données Microsoft SQL Express

Maintenant, vous devez vous connecter pour créer des bases de données SQL avec l'utilisateur créé. Pour ce faire, veuillez exécuter "cmd" sur votre ordinateur et tapez "sqlcmd -U ozekiuser -P ozekipass". (Figure 2) Après avoir appuyé sur Entrée, vous pourrez exécuter des instructions SQL directement depuis cmd avec les droits de l'utilisateur créé.

Figure 2 - Se connecter avec l'utilisateur créé

sqlcmd -U ozekiuser -P ozekipass

Ensuite, vous devez créer une table adaptée à la passerelle SMS Ozeki. Ici, sur la Figure 3, nous vous fournissons une instruction qui crée la table SQL parfaite pour vos besoins. Si vous êtes familier avec SQL, n'hésitez pas à modifier le code selon vos préférences exactes.


use ozekidb
GO

CREATE TABLE ozekimessagein (
 id int IDENTITY (1,1),
 sender varchar(255),
 receiver varchar(255),
 msg nvarchar(160),
 senttime varchar(100),
 receivedtime varchar(100),
 operator varchar(30),
 msgtype varchar(30),
 reference varchar(30),
);
 
CREATE TABLE ozekimessageout (
 id int IDENTITY (1,1),
 sender varchar(255),
 receiver varchar(255),
 msg nvarchar(160),
 senttime varchar(100),
 receivedtime varchar(100),
 operator varchar(100),
 msgtype varchar(30),
 reference varchar(30),
 status varchar(30),
 errormsg varchar(250)
);
 
GO

Figure 3 - Instruction CREATE TABLE

Pour créer les tables, vous devez donner à "sqlcmd" quelques instructions. Copiez le code de la Figure 3. Ces instructions créent les tables pour les messages entrants et sortants.

Maintenant, veuillez coller le code copié à l'étape précédente dans le sqlcmd que vous avez créé à la Figure 1. De cette façon, le programme peut comprendre et exécuter les instructions. Dans cette étape, vous pouvez modifier le code fourni si vous êtes familier avec le langage SQL. Appuyez sur Entrée pour exécuter le code et créer les tables. Vous pouvez voir le code dans le sqlcmd sur la Figure 4.

exécuter l'instruction create table sur la base de données
Figure 4 - Exécuter l'instruction CREATE TABLE sur la base de données

Nous espérons que ce guide a été utile. Si vous rencontrez un problème avec l'une des étapes, n'hésitez pas à nous contacter à info @ ozeki.hu

More information